基于永磁同步电机直接转矩复合型滑模控制器的设计 被引量:1

Design of Sliding-mode Direct Torque Controller Based on PMSM
下载PDF
导出
摘要 文中针对传统直接转矩控制系统中PI算法对电机参数和负载变化敏感的不足,提出了一种复合滑模控制器,该控制器由一积分切换自适应滑模控制器并联一积分环节构成。经仿真验证,表明该方法能提高系统鲁棒性,在相同仿真条件下,比使用传统PI算法,使得转矩和转速的波动分别减小了15%和4%左右,从而证明了该方法的可行性。 The PI algorithm in the traditional direct torque system isn't sensitive enough to the variance of system parameter and load. a complex sliding-mode controller was proposed. The controller consists of adaptive sliding-mode based on integral switching and integral part. The results of computer simulation verify the new controller can improve robustness under the same simulation condition. The 15 % torque and around 4% velocity fluctuation has been reduced compared with the traditional PI algorithm, the effectiveness of the designed scheme is showed.
